Arnold had $120 and Lucy had $36 at first. After they each bought a book for the same price, Lucy had 1/5 as much money as Arnold had. How much did the book cost?

Let price of book = x
money arnold had after buying the book = 120-x
money lucy had after buying the book = 36-x
Money lucy has compared to arnold: 36-x = 1/5(120-x)
36-x = (120-x)/5
multiply both side by 5
5(36-x) = 120-x
180-5x = 120-x
add 5x to both sides
180 = 120 + 4x
180 -120 = 4x
4x = 60
Therefore x = $15. So the price of the book is 15.
Now you can test this value
Money lucy had after buying the book = 36-15 = 21
Money Arnold had after buying the book = 120-15 = 105
And 21 is exactly one-fifth of 105 which is the money arnold had
